1. I use Interactive Brokers so we know TWS has to logout once every 24 hours. To work around this i use: IBController application. Or i use IB Gateway which automatically connects again.
2. I use a VPS with only Multichats, IB, Time Sync (to ensure correct time) and Splahstop remote desktop app. So far my VPS (tried godaddy) has had zero down time for first couple months. I only have 3gb ram which i find more than enough but i like to run IB Gateway recently because it takes far less resources.
3. I have many strategies running at the same time, many strategies trade the same symbol. I use alerts (mainly email alerts - i am finding only Yahoo email works).

8. I know sometime MC has data issues or where certain number of bars did not load properly. I am thinking of adding reload: .rld command to reload last days data at certain time. Does anybody think this is a good idea?
9. In-case of software failure (if i use IBController with TWS) i use windows scheduling tool to ensure the application runs again - keeps checking every 5 seconds if software is running.
